The Humane Society here has a setup that if you register as a feral colony caretaker, you can get lower priced spays and neuters, which is a good thing. My colony is all spayed and neutered, but I was considering registering them anyway, because some of my neighbors, I am afraid, will try to hurt the cats. I believe the Humane Society shares this info with Animal Control.

Have any of you heard of such a thing, first of all, and have any of you registered your feral colonies?

I would instead make a trip to the shelter and tell them that you privately TNR a few feral cats a year. That is what I did, and the shelter gave me a handful of spay and neuter gift certificates that I use. I would not register a colony, unless required by a law.
